如何用react-router v6实现权限控制并自动切换页面案例?

2026-05-18 03:304阅读0评论SEO教程
  • 内容介绍
  • 文章标签
  • 相关推荐

本文共计1833个文字,预计阅读时间需要8分钟。

如何用react-router v6实现权限控制并自动切换页面案例?

目录 + 权限管理 + 总结 + 学习React+TS一段时间,想写个项目练手。由于初次写React+TS项目,遇到很多未知,加之之前写Vue项目,转换到React感到不适应。

目录
  • 权限管理
  • 总结

学了一段时间的react+ts,想着写一个项目练练手,由于初次写react+ts项目,有很多东西并不知道应该怎么写,再加上之前写vue项目的习惯,突然转换react有点不习惯,有很多在vue中的写法,并不知道是否在react中仍然可行。写项目之前先考虑了权限管理,第一次使用react-router v6 也不知道是否有更好的写法。这次就来简单分享一下我实现权限管理以及拦截器中遇到的一些问题。

权限管理

这次项目是有三种权限,分别是用户,商家以及管理员。这次写的权限管理是高级权限能访问低级权限的所有页面,但是低级权限不能访问高级权限的页面。

阅读全文

本文共计1833个文字,预计阅读时间需要8分钟。

如何用react-router v6实现权限控制并自动切换页面案例?

目录 + 权限管理 + 总结 + 学习React+TS一段时间,想写个项目练手。由于初次写React+TS项目,遇到很多未知,加之之前写Vue项目,转换到React感到不适应。

目录
  • 权限管理
  • 总结

学了一段时间的react+ts,想着写一个项目练练手,由于初次写react+ts项目,有很多东西并不知道应该怎么写,再加上之前写vue项目的习惯,突然转换react有点不习惯,有很多在vue中的写法,并不知道是否在react中仍然可行。写项目之前先考虑了权限管理,第一次使用react-router v6 也不知道是否有更好的写法。这次就来简单分享一下我实现权限管理以及拦截器中遇到的一些问题。

权限管理

这次项目是有三种权限,分别是用户,商家以及管理员。这次写的权限管理是高级权限能访问低级权限的所有页面,但是低级权限不能访问高级权限的页面。

阅读全文